I know we've discussed some of the flaws of the show, here's what I think could improve the show...

How about letting the contestants speak for themselves? Why does Rossi have to speak for the players at the start of the show? Perhaps an extra moment or so to get to know the players?

As discussed before, the final speed round should be a full minute

Rossi should reveal the answers to questions missed AFTER the time is up, not during the speed round. This might leave more time for an extra 2 or three questions. Also, it is totally unnecessary for Rossi to state the correct answer during the 2 answer speed round.

Perhaps Rossi's explanation of the rules at the start could be shortened too. That might allow for more gameplay/contestant interaction.

The overly feminine prizes and enforcing the stereotype of how women love to shop needs to stop too.

My proposed changes:

1. Dump the Knock Off round in favor of maybe more questions or the classic Fame Game
2. In the final speed round, each question is worth $5 during the first thirty seconds, and $10 for the second thirty seconds.
3. After the car, reaching $1,250 wins all the prizes on stage plus a cash jackpot that starts at $50,000 and goes up $1,000 for each show it isn't won.

I would keep Super Knock Off for Part 1 of the endgame, though.
